Control Room
The LTX control room (L208) serves as the center of machine operation, housing several computers which monitor and control LTX systems.
Computer Terminals
- Bender: North end of western wall. Main run computer. Hosts the Run VI and automated analysis scripts.
- Nibbler: Southern wall. OH control computer; communicates with OH PXI chassis via VIs for control and acquisition. Typically used for Remote Desktop to LTX-Fry-NB7 for nbGUI.
- Peabody: North end of eastern wall. Previously communicated with Chronos DTACQ. Deprecated?
- Leela: Eastern wall. Communicates with QCDM controllers and stepper motor controller.
- Zoidberg: Eastern wall. Has three monitors. Communicates with thermocouple readers, ion gauge controller, and both vessel and beam tank RGAs. Also houses the filament bias control interface.
- Hermes: Remote to NI PXI computer for RTD and Thermocouple Labview VIs.
- LRRR: WinSpec and Visual Basic to control CHERS Holospec camera.
- Donbot: WinSpec and Visual Basic to control CHERS Isoplane spectrometer and camera.
- Clamps: WinSpec and Visual Basic to control Thomson scattering Holospec camera.
- ?: Western wall. Large wall display for shot waveforms and video.
- ?,?,?: Eastern wall. Large wall displays for test cell webcams.
Terminals Outside Control Room
- Hypnotoad: Shared SolidWorks workstation. In L232 (postdoc office) next to Drew Elliott's desk.
- Fry: Neutral beam control computer. In L111 (neutral beam cell), inside the neutral beam cage.
